MUMBAI: According to details, Mumbai real estate market has seen a hike in prices as luxury highrise buildings continue to be sold.
As per details, prominent individuals are buying luxury properties in South Mumbai. Two such individuals are Creative Plastics Group and Indian Singer, Sonu Nigam.
Sonu Nigam purchased two apartments in Unicorn Building in Andheri West for a whooping INR 11.37 crores.
Similarly, Creatives Plastics Group purchased eight units for INR 154.6 crores.
According to the founder and MD of Liases Foras, “Luxury housing in Mumbai witnessed a spike in supply last year. In 2022, we saw a 76% increase in the new launches of units costing Rs 3 crore and above”.
Moreover, as per global property consultancy firm, Knight Frank India, only 1% of the apartments sold in 2023 in Mumbai were priced at INR 20 crore while 4% were priced between INR 5 crore and INR 10 crore.
